The Smok tanks I had came with two color gaskets for the glass tank section (the orange ones in the picture in your first post). They were replacements, and also to change the look of the tank. Let's say if you were to put a black tank on a green mod, you could swap the gaskets out to the green ones to match the mod.

For those orange ones pictured, the larger one goes on the bottom of the glass, and the smaller one goes on the top, if I remember correctly. But I very well could have those mixed up, it's been a while since I messed with a tank.

The O rings are to seal the various pieces of the tank from leaking air and or liquid, those that meet / seal with glass also provide a slight bit of protection from glass to metal contact.

If your new tank didn't come with any O rings installed that would indicate a manufacturing mistake / defect, or the tank isn't new or a possible clone/fake.
Or maybe the person that gave it to you disassembled to clean / wash it so it was ready to use and in the process lost the O rings or didn't pay attention to where they went & left them out.

I've never heard of a tank that doesn't come fully assembled with all o rings & seals in place as they should be.

I don't imagine that they're any different than any other o-ring in that they're there to make a seal so that you don't get leakages between two separate non fused parts. I apologize if I'm not understanding the question. Basically rubber or silicone will help to make the seal since it's somewhat malleable compared to a glass against metal where there could never be a true seal. Because two very hard surfaces are not going to seal as well as to hard surfaces with a rubbery one in the middle.
